With these new displays and home CNC machines, it's clear that we really are living in the future aren't we? Decades ago we'd be talking about putting 4" CRTs in the marquee. With the proliferation of small LCD devices, we move on to something like an iPod or android/iPhone screen. When RGB panels came out, that looked inviting for a while but too low res. Then the advertising LCDs came out and the first dynamic marquee project used those, but they were pricey. Now you can get a variety of sizes from aliexpress for less than $200. Just wait a few years for foldable displays and you can have the marquee, display, and CPO be one big piece  :lol

How does this software differ from x360ce. I would really like to test this out with my G29 but since it does not have GUI and is just code based it looks a bit intimidating. Are there any easy user friendly guides where i can follow? I did check it's README, i found it to be a bit confusing.

Just wait a little bit. I have been pushing hard on an update that was worth the wait. I've been fortunate to have a team of beta testers in the discord that have been helping iron it out. I will update this thread when it is ready. Guess the software didn't die in 2022 after all!

There’s a lot of cross-over between this and x360ce to be fair. However, for me at least, I got fed up of x360 constantly deleting settings and never really getting to grips with the per game configs. Never had any such problems with W2X.

Another key benefit is not only being able to map multiple devices to single xinput bindings (which you can also do with x360) but then with any of those individual devices also being able to map multiple buttons from them to a single xinput outputs- which you can’t do in x360 (it will clear a binding if you try to map elsewhere on the same device - see my crazy taxi example above). There’s also I believe benefits of being able send FFB to multiple devices which I’ve yet to explore.

Thanks for responding. You are correct, you can do one-to-many and many-to-one mappings. There will be a lot of fine-grained control that I think will be more relevant for anyone with an FFB device than a generic x360ce implementation.

Spacewing War

Steam
Spacewing War

Native resolution is 160x144 GameBoy
Set display resolution to 320x240
Window Size 1x
Then use Integer scaling.
I used GameScope in Linux but should work just the same using integer-scaler


Perfect integer scaling just like GameBoy Player
